Abstract

A few layered ternary Cu-In-Se compound is synthesized, the photoconductivity is measured, and 2D photovoltaic devices are fabricated. Few-layered CuIn7 Se11 has a strong photoresponse and the potential to serve as the active medium in ultra-thin photovoltaic devices.
